RIC VIII Amiens 3, Large AE2, Bronze, struck at Ambianum, 350–353 AD. Obverse: bust of magnentius, bareheaded, draped, cuirassed, right; a behind bust. Reverse: magnentius, draped, cuirassed, galloping right, spearing barbarian kneeling below horse with outstretched arms with right hand and holding shield on left arm; below horse, shield and broken spear. Weight about 4.2 g, diameter 20.0 mm.
